I have a franke Saphira it says decalcify needed what buttons do i press and is there a sequence how to press them .

first you need to shut down the machine by pressing the on/off button in the frontpanel. now you can press the decalcify-button on the frontpanel. Follow instructions on display.

How do i connect CBL-0084 l Frontpanel ?

Normally you will find the answer in your motherboard manual. The plug that connected to the front panel is keyed so it can only go in one way. Please reallize this is only a guess, as I do not know anything about your machine.

Frontpanel sound

By default, the pins labeled LINE OUT_R/BLINE_OUT_R and the pins LINE OUT_L/BLINE_OUT_L are shortened with jumper caps. You should remove the caps ONLY when you are connecting the front audio cable. So, if you are going to use the back panel, you should short the pins mentioned earlier. You cannot use the back panel and the front panel at the same time. If you want to use your headphones using the back panel, short the mentioned pins and connect your headphones to the green header of your back panel audio. If you want to use the front panel, take off the jumper caps and connect the front panel cable. Remember, if you connect the front panel audio cable, you won't be able to use the back panel. If you are going to use the back panel, don't forget to return the jumper caps. Usually the 5-6 and 9-10 pins. Hope this helps.
